31/10/2018 (Agence Europe) – With Denmark having thwarted an attack on its soil and accusing Iran of being behind it, the spokesperson for the European External Action Service, Maja Kocijancic, said on Wednesday 31 October that the EU expected the Danish authorities' debrief to member states "as soon as possible". "We have seen the report about a significant incident in Danemark (...) We are in touch with Danish authorities at several levels and expect their debrief to member states as soon as possible", Kocijancic told press, saying that the investigation is led by the Danish authorities. She also deplored any threat to EU security, adding that every incident was taken "very seriously". Denmark's Prime Minister Lars Lokke Rasmussen said that "measures against Iran (would be) discussed within the EU". (CG)
